Understanding the core components of betting platform architecture is essential for anyone looking to develop or enhance their sports betting site. The architecture typically consists of several critical elements, including the user interface, gaming engine, data processing unit, and payment processing systems. User interfaces must be intuitive and responsive to provide an enhanced user experience, while the gaming engine manages the logic and algorithms to ensure fair play. Data processing units are vital for analyzing user data and balancing odds, which contributes to the overall reliability of the platform.
Another key aspect of betting platform architecture is scalability. A robust system must be able to handle increased traffic and transactions, especially during peak times like major sports events. To achieve this, developers often incorporate microservices architecture that allows individual components to scale independently. Additionally, security measures are paramount; the platform must protect user data and transactions from potential threats. By understanding and implementing these core components, developers can create a more efficient and secure betting environment that meets user demands.

Designing a scalable and secure betting system requires a deep understanding of both the technical and regulatory landscapes. To achieve scalability, you should start by adopting a microservices architecture that allows different components of the system to operate and scale independently. This can include using cloud services to handle fluctuating user loads and ensuring that your databases are optimized for rapid access. Additionally, implementing load balancing techniques can distribute incoming traffic evenly across your servers, preventing any single point of failure and ensuring a smooth user experience.
Security is paramount in any betting system where sensitive user data and financial transactions are involved. Implementing strong encryption protocols and secure payment gateways is essential to protect user information from potential breaches. Moreover, incorporating regular security audits and compliance checks will help you stay ahead of potential threats. Consider using advanced authentication mechanisms, such as two-factor authentication (2FA), to enhance user security further. Finally, it's crucial to stay updated with the latest industry regulations to ensure your betting platform remains compliant and secure.
Modern betting platforms leverage a variety of advanced technologies to enhance user experience and streamline operations. At the core of these systems is cloud computing, which allows for scalable resources and flexibility. This technology supports real-time data processing, enabling platforms to offer live betting and instant updates on odds. Additionally, the implementation of artificial intelligence (AI) is revolutionizing how betting operators analyze data. With predictive analytics, AI tools assess player behavior and trends to improve odds and offer personalized betting experiences.
Another critical technology powering betting platforms is blockchain. This decentralized technology enhances transparency and security, allowing players to verify transactions and ensuring the integrity of betting outcomes. Furthermore, mobile technology plays a vital role in the modern betting landscape, with the majority of users now betting via smartphones. Robust payment gateways integrated into these platforms offer multiple transaction methods, from credit cards to cryptocurrencies, improving customer satisfaction and accessibility.
